Output f06e1582aa502d9a3217dcb2438c926191c7ce66e7fca83e954c64d0af5b4e01:0

value
595223
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e672269b048a006dfc8e9f7c4a056a6d53285dc OP_EQUALVERIFY OP_CHECKSIG
address
1QCABdZiWLTrnEkKeBYsqBff4H23UY18tX
transaction
f06e1582aa502d9a3217dcb2438c926191c7ce66e7fca83e954c64d0af5b4e01
spent
true